Output ab6bbca7951c41efce95b884d966433c51043898829a7fe193f11426ce2f34de:120

value
14907
script pubkey
OP_0 OP_PUSHBYTES_20 e68dfbe28e071edc5fc82d068b366094f8f9b6e7
address
bc1qu6xlhc5wqu0dch7g95rgkdnqjnu0ndh8hrp9g2
transaction
ab6bbca7951c41efce95b884d966433c51043898829a7fe193f11426ce2f34de
spent
true